As for the Storybooks, well they're more of a roleplaying thing. Where someone comes up with a plot and a whole lot of people create characters and continue the story on. At least that's what I think they are. I'm not too sure myself. One thing I do know is that they're not for short stories or anything of that kind.

You can post your short stories and other various things in the tabs along the top that says 'Submit'. Then pick which category whatever you're about to submit it in and voila! Your short story/poem/lyric/etc. is now posted up.
